Dan wrote:Speaking of Belew... How are his solo albums? People told me they're pretty good, but I only know his work in KC and with Zappa.
His latest album is really good (he collaborated with Les Claypool for about half the album). It's all generic songs about love and madness and whatnot. Reminds me of a mishmosh of '80s and '90s Crimson (particularly the weird love ballads).
His previous stuff is mostly acoustic, and I wouldn't recommend it as much, but it's worth a listen. Belew is a very talented musician.
